What Weight Is Classed As Obese?

    Weight is not the regular factor when obesity is being calculated. Standing on a bathroom scale and getting the measurement of your weight is not an appropriate way to find out if you are obese or not. It is important that you find out your body mass in order to determine if you are obese. You can go to any doctors office and find out you body mass as most nurses are trained to check and measure body mass.

    Body mass is calculated with the help of your exact weight and height. This measurement is called Body Mass Index and can give you an idea about how over weight are you. If your body mass is between 30 to 34.9 means you are class 1 obese, 35 to 39.9 class 2 obese, 40 or more means class 3 obese which is the most severe stage of being obese.
